Top Platforms Offering Free Courses with Valued Certifications

1. Coursera

Partnered with top universities and organizations, Coursera offers numerous free courses. While many courses are free to audit, obtaining a certificate may require a fee, but many financial aid options are available. Notable courses include Google’s IT Support Professional Certificate and IBM Data Science Professional Certificate.

2. edX

Founded by Harvard and MIT, edX provides high-quality courses across diverse subjects. Many courses are free to access, with the option to earn verified certificates for a fee. Look for courses from Microsoft, Harvard, and other top institutions.

3. Google Digital Garage

Google’s free training platform offers certifications in digital marketing, data analytics, and more. Their Google Analytics Certification and Fundamentals of Digital Marketing are highly regarded.

4. LinkedIn Learning

While primarily subscription-based, LinkedIn Learning offers some free courses and certifications that can be directly added to your LinkedIn profile, increasing visibility to potential employers.

5.  Udacity

Known for tech-focused courses, Udacity offers free courses in programming, AI, data science, and more. Their Nanodegree programs come at a cost but offer industry-recognized credentials.

6. FutureLearn

Partnered with universities and organizations, FutureLearn offers free courses with optional paid certificates. Courses include digital skills, health, business, and more.

7. Alison

Specializes in free courses with certificates in areas like project management, HR, health, and language learning, with options for paid diplomas.

Popular Free Courses with Recognized Certifications

1. Google IT Support Professional Certificate

  • Focus: IT support, troubleshooting, customer service.
  • Recognition: Valued by employers looking for entry-level IT roles.
  • Duration: Approx. 6 months (self-paced).  

2. IBM Data Science Professional Certificate

  • Focus: Data analysis, Python, machine learning, data visualization.
  • Recognition: Valued in data-driven industries.
  • Duration: Approx. 3-6 months.  

3. Meta Social Media Marketing Professional Certificate  

  • Focus: Social media advertising, content creation, analytics.
  • Recognition: Digital marketing roles.
  • Duration: Approx. 4 weeks.  

4. Microsoft Excel Skills for Business

  • Focus: Data management, analysis, formulas, and pivot tables.
  • Recognition: Business and finance roles.
  • Duration: Varies.  

5. Digital Marketing by Google

  • Focus: SEO, SEM, analytics, content marketing.
  • Recognition: Digital marketing and advertising positions.
  • Duration: 40 hours.  

6. Introduction to Cyber Security by Cisco

  • Focus: Cybersecurity fundamentals, threat detection.
  • Recognition: Security roles across industries.
  • Duration: Approx. 4 weeks.  

7. Fundamentals of Project Management by PMI

  • Focus: Project planning, execution, risk management.
  • Recognition: Project management roles.
  • Duration: Varies.  

How to Make the Most of Free Certifications

1. Select Relevant Courses

Identify skills that are in demand in your target industry or role. Use job descriptions as guides to select courses that match employer expectations.

2. Complete Courses Thoroughly

Engage actively with the material. Complete all assignments, quizzes, and practical projects to deepen your understanding.

3. Showcase Your Certifications  

Add your certificates to your LinkedIn profile, digital portfolio, or resume. Highlight them during interviews and in cover letters.

4. Continue Learning

Use free courses as a starting point. Enroll in advanced courses or specializations to build on your initial knowledge.

5. Network and Engage 

Join online communities, forums, and social media groups related to your field. Networking can open up opportunities and provide insights into industry trends.

6. Apply Your Skills 

Seek internships, freelance projects, or volunteer opportunities to apply your newly acquired skills practically.

Tips for Validating and Choosing Courses

  1. Check Course Accreditation: Ensure the course is offered by a reputable organization or university.
  2. Read Course Reviews: Look for feedback from previous learners to assess quality and relevance.
  3. Verify Certification Recognition: Some certificates are more valued than others; research their industry acceptance.
  4. Assess Course Content: Ensure the curriculum aligns with current industry standards and covers practical skills.

The Future of Free Online Certifications

As online education continues to grow, more organizations recognize the importance of accessible learning. The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ated this trend, making remote learning a norm. Employers increasingly view skills and certifications from recognized online courses as valid indicators of capability, especially when traditional education options are limited. Additionally, micro-credentials and digital badges are emerging as innovative ways to validate skills in a visual and shareable format.
